Top 5 Disney Games Apps on Android in Oceania Q1 2022

In Q1 2022, the top 5 Disney games on Android in Oceania showcased diverse trends in weekly downloads, revenue, and active users. The data, provided by Sensor Tower, reveals interesting patterns for each game.

Disney Emoji Blitz Game from Jam City, Inc. experienced a fluctuating revenue stream, peaking at approximately $5.5K in the last week of March. Weekly downloads saw a significant rise mid-quarter, hitting a high of 2.2K in the week of February 21. Active users increased steadily from 1.5K at the start of the quarter to a peak of 2.8K by mid-March before slightly declining to 2.5K at the end of the quarter.

Star Wars™: Galaxy of Heroes by ELECTRONIC ARTS maintained a robust revenue, peaking at around $46K in the third week of March. The weekly downloads remained relatively stable, hovering around 1K to 1.3K throughout the quarter. Active users were also consistent, averaging around 22K each week.

Disney Coloring World by StoryToys saw a modest revenue, with weekly peaks around $419 in mid-January and $348 at the end of March. Downloads fluctuated, reaching a high of 1.7K in the final week of March. The active user base grew from 1.6K at the start of the quarter to 2.3K by the end.

LEGO® DUPLO® MARVEL, also by StoryToys, showed steady revenue around $200 to $300 throughout the quarter. Weekly downloads remained mostly stable, with a slight dip in February but ending strong at 918 in the last week of March. Active users increased from 870 at the beginning of the quarter to 1.5K by the end.

MARVEL Future Fight by Netmarble experienced a varied revenue trend, peaking at $4.7K at the end of December and fluctuating around $2K to $3.4K through the quarter. Downloads saw a sharp decline from 1.9K in mid-January to under 200 by the end of March. Active users started at 9.3K, peaked at 10K in mid-January, and settled around 7.5K by the quarter's end.
